How To Make PDF File Smaller On Mac
We'll now walk you through the procedures to make your PDF smaller on Mac. You'll be able to see that getting the light PDF you so desperately need is a rapid and easy process. All you need is an excellent online tool to carry out the task.
You can quickly reduce your PDF size from your Mac with macOS by doing the following:
- Go to formatpdf.com/en/compress-pdf/.
- The huge PDF file you want to compress can now be uploaded. Click where it says "Select PDF file," or simply drag the file into the red window with the text to accomplish this.
- After completing the steps mentioned above, you'll see how the vast PDF compression tool's interface currently looks. You've three compression settings on the right side of your screen: Extreme, Recommended, and Low. Select the option that best suits you, then clicks the "Compress PDF" button immediately below these choices. Check the box next to each PDF that you've uploaded.
- To distribute or save the generated compressed PDF wherever you like, you'll need to download it. You can do so by clicking the "Download" button.
Now you have got a smaller PDF ready to share from your Mac.
What Do You Need To Know About Making A PDF Smaller On Mac
We're now going to provide you with some beneficial advice related to making a PDF smaller on macOS. To ensure that you don't run into any issues, we advise that you pay attention to what follows.
Following are some of the critical factors that you need to consider while reducing the size of a PDF file on Mac using this online tool:
- If the PDF is locked, we advise you to unlock it before compressing it. If you can't remember the password, you've "Unlock PDF" cloud-based software.
- Since mistakes might happen when something is sent by email, you should always try to preserve a copy of the original file.
- Always go over the generated PDF to avoid any sort of mistakes. For instance, your final PDF file may contain grammatical errors, which are not good if you're willing to send it to someone.
- If you'd instead not compress a document, you can email it in pieces using a PDF splitting tool.
